Hi, I'm Bria.

My love for plants didn't begin with a nursery or a gardening class. It began with a man named Jim.

I started out just walking his golden retriever, Sophie. Over time, Jim and his wife Becky brought me into their lives in a bigger way, and I ended up spending my afternoons with him in the garden. I watered their plants every day, and I'd hand him his tools while he trimmed his bonsai trees  slow, careful, precise, like he was performing surgery. He didn't say much. He didn't have to. I watched him build a fountain from scratch, shape trees that had been growing for decades, and turn ordinary plants into something that felt alive in a whole new way.

Somewhere in those months, I realized how healing it actually is to take care of something living. Watching a plant respond to patience, to the right light, to just being paid attention to it settled something in me. It still does.

Jim passed away last April after a long fight with cancer, and every plant I grow now carries a little bit of what he taught me.

That's where Bria's Planties really started.
